Suppose that you can hire your mechanic in finely divisible increments (H: hours of employment). Your benefit and cost functions are B(H) = 2000H and C(H) = 80H + 100H2. a) What is your marginal benefit and marginal cost when H=4? b) In order to maximize your net benefit (the difference between total benefit and total cost), how many H should you hire?
